A Non-Surgical Approach Built on Breathing & Awareness
Think of your spine like a twisted corkscrewthat's essentially what scoliosis does. The Schroth method for scoliosis tackles this complexity by working in all directions at once.
- Focuses on posture correction in all three planes: front/back, side-to-side, and rotation.
- Works by de-rotating, elongating, and stabilizing the spine.
- Built on principles developed by Katharina Schroth, a woman who had scoliosis herselfand refused to accept bracing as the only answer.
- Evolved over generations: now includes Schroth Best Practice, a refined, evidence-based version.

It's Not One-Size-Fits-All: How Personalization Works
This isn't a workout video you follow along with. Every person's scoliosis is as unique as their fingerprint, and the exercises are designed accordingly.
- Your scoliosis curve pattern (C or S shape, direction, location) determines your exercise plan.
- Example: A left thoracic curve needs different breathing and positioning than a right lumbar curve.
- Uses mirrors and tactile cues so you "feel" the correction in real time.
- Taught by certified Schroth therapistsnot just any physio.

How Schroth Exercises Work: The 3 Key Pillars
This is where the rubber meets the road.
1. Muscular Symmetry Fixing Imbalances
Picture this: You're carrying a heavy bag on one shoulder every day. Eventually, that side gets stronger, the other weaker, and your whole body adjusts. Scoliosis creates a similar imbalance, but internally.
- Scoliosis pulls muscles unevenly: some tighten, others weaken.
- Exercises target asymmetrical muscle groups to rebalance them.
- Goal: even shoulders, hips, and rib cagenot just visually, but functionally.
It's like being a human sculptor, gently reshaping your own body's imbalances. Sounds intense? It can be. But patients often describe feeling "more even" afterward.
2. Rotational Angular Breathing (RAB) Breathing to Reshape
This is the secret weapon.
- Instead of normal breathing, you breathe into the concave (collapsed) side of your ribcage.
- That targeted expansion helps de-rotate the spine and reduce rib humping.
- Backed by research: Dr. Weiss' studies show RAB improves lung function and curve stability.

3. Postural Awareness Training Your Brain-Body Connection
You learn to "auto-correct" your spineanywhere, anytime.
- Use mirrors during therapy to see and feel proper alignment.
- Practice carrying it into daily life: sitting, walking, sleeping.
- It's like building a new habitpainful at first, then automatic.

Who Should Consider the Schroth Method?
Spoiler: Not just teens.
Adolescents The Gold Standard for Non-Surgical Care
Best when started before skeletal maturity.
- High chance of halting progression, even reducing Cobb angle.
- Intensive programs (520 sessions) help kids "lock in" skills before growth spurts.
- Research shows short-term Cobb angle reduction (~3) and improved QoL.
The earlier, the better. Think of it like learning a language when you're youngit just clicks easier.
Adults Pain Relief & Posture, Not Curve Reversal
Focus shifts from curve correction to pain management and stability.
- Helps with stiffness, fatigue, and breathing issues from long-term scoliosis.
- Realistic goals: better movement, fewer meds, improved daily life.
Many adults tell me they wish they'd known about this decades ago. While we can't turn back time, we can definitely improve quality of life.
Post-Surgery Patients Regain Strength & Awareness
Can help improve core stability and postural control after surgery.
- Doesn't fix the fused areabut helps surrounding muscles work better.
- Often overlooked, but valuable for long-term function.

What Are the Real Benefits of Schroth Therapy?
Spoiler: More than just curves.
Physical Improvements You Can Measure
| Benefit | Evidence & Outcome |
|---|---|
| Halts curve progression | Most consistent result, especially in adolescents |
| Cobb angle reduction | Small but significant (~25) in short term; varies by study |
| Reduced trunk rotation | Measurable via NIH or scoliometer |
| Improved posture | Visual symmetry: shoulders, hips, head alignment |
| Better lung function | Increased FVC, FEV1 from rotational breathing |
Quality of Life Gains (Often the Real Win)
- Less back and rib pain
- Easier breathing
- More energy during the day
- Better body image and confidence
- Fewer limitations in activity

What to Expect From Schroth Therapy
No sugarcoating: it's work.
How It's Taught In Person, by a Specialist
Not DIY from YouTube. Proper form is everything.
- Sessions: 4560 mins, 420 visits depending on age and severity.
- Frequency: Weekly or intensive (daily for 12 weeks).
- Therapists: Must be certified in Schroth or Schroth Best Practice.
I know it's tempting to try to save money, but trust me on this onedoing it wrong can actually make things worse.
What Happens in a Session?
- Posture assessment using mirrors and palpation
- Custom exercise demonstration
- Hands-on guidance (tactile cues for breathing/spine position)
- Homework: Daily home program (2030 mins)
- Re-evaluation every 34 months

Schroth + Bracing: A Powerful Combo
They're not mutually exclusive.
Chneau-Gensingen Brace Designed to Work With Schroth
- Asymmetrical, 3D design based on Schroth principles.
- Created by Dr. Hans-Rudolf Weissgrandson of Katharina Schroth.
- Allows active correction while bracedpatient can use RAB inside the brace.
Imagine wearing a brace that actually works with your body instead of just holding it in place. That's the difference this approach makes.
Why Combine Them?
- Bracing = external support
- Schroth = internal muscle & breathing correction
- Together: greater chance of curve stabilization or reduction
- Ideal for adolescents with curves 2545 and remaining growth

Limitations & Real Talk
Be honest. Build trust.
It Won't "Cure" Scoliosis
- Goal is management, not elimination.
- Spine won't become perfectly straight.
- Most effective when started early.
This isn't about perfectionit's about progress. Small steps that add up to big changes.
Requires Daily Effort Forever
- Home exercises are non-negotiable.
- Skipping = loss of gains.
- It's a lifestyle, not a quick fix.
I know, I know. "Forever" sounds scary. But think about brushing your teethdo you love it? Probably not. But you do it because you know the consequences of not doing it.
Not a Replacement for Surgery in Severe Cases
- Curves over 5060 may still need surgery.
- Schroth can help pre-op strength or post-op recovery, but not reverse severe deformity.

FAQs
What is the Schroth method for scoliosis?
The Schroth method is a non-surgical, physical therapy approach using customized exercises to correct spinal imbalances, reduce curve progression, and improve posture in people with scoliosis.
Can the Schroth method straighten the spine?
It can help reduce the degree of curvature and prevent worsening, especially in adolescents. However, it does not completely straighten the spine.
Who can benefit from Schroth therapy?
Adolescents, adults, and even post-surgical patients can benefit. It’s most effective when started early but can help manage pain and posture at any age.
How long does Schroth therapy take to show results?
Patients often notice improvements in posture and pain within weeks. Structural changes may take months and depend on consistency with daily home exercises.
Is the Schroth method a replacement for surgery?
No, it’s not a substitute for severe cases requiring surgery. However, it can help delay or avoid surgery in mild to moderate cases and support recovery post-surgery.
